This manual shows what can be done with XML, while also teaching where the technology is headed. It includes topics like displaying XML files in HTML files, performing queries in XSL and building an online store.

Charles Ashbacher is the long-time co-editor of "Journal of Recreational" mathematics in charge of manuscript content and book reviews. He has also been a college instructor in mathematics and computer science for many years and is an avid reader and reviewer.
